Kempton Park SPCA invites community to AGM

The meeting will be held at Kairos Hall, NG Kerk Hoogland, De Wiekus Road, Van Riebeeck Park at 13:00.

The management committee of the Kempton Park SPCA invites members of the community to attend the society’s AGM on July 11.

The meeting will take place at 13:00 at Kairos Hall, NG Kerk Hoogland, De Wiekus Road, Van Riebeeck Park, and is open to all community members aged 16 years and older.

To assist with planning arrangements, attendees are requested to RSVP by July 10 via email to secretary@kemptonspca.co.za.

AGM packs will be available one week before the meeting. Anyone wishing to receive a copy in advance is encouraged to email the secretary and request an AGM pack.

“We look forward to sharing the society’s progress, achievements, challenges and plans for the future with our supporters and community members,” said Kempton Park SPCA manager Javone Lewis.
